A. 1 and 2 Lee Fort Terrace – DEP# 64-756 – (Continued) - Public Hearing- Notice of Intent – of BC Lee Fort Terrace LLC, 2 Center Plaza, Boston MA. The purpose of this hearing is to discuss the proposed replacement of 50 apartments with 124 apartments, associated garage, surface parking, outdoor community space and   new public open space at the property located at 1 and 2 Lee Fort Terrace, Map 41, Lots 242 and 249, Salem MA. The proposed work is located within an area subject to protection under the Wetlands Protection Act MGL c.131§40 and Salem Wetlands Protection & Conservation Ordinance.

B. 10 White Street – Salem Harbor Marinas - DEP# 64-### –Notice of Intent for Safe Harbors Marina –10 White Street, Salem Ma. The public hearing is to review the replacement of existing timber floats, installation of new mooring piles, and minor relocation of floats and mooring piles located at Hawthorne Cove Marina an area subject to protection under the Wetlands Protection Act MGL c.131§40 and Salem Wetlands Protection & Conservation Ordinance. 

C. 67 Derby Street – Salem Wharf - DEP# 64-### - Notice of Intent for Crowley Wind Services on behalf of Fort Point Associates, 31 State Street, Boston, for geotechnical borings and test pits for the Salem Wind Port Project, 67 Derby Street, located in Land Subject to Coastal Storm Flowage subject to protection under the Wetlands Protection Act MGL c.131§40 and Salem Wetlands Protection & Conservation Ordinance. -* Richard Jabba NOI –22-28

D. 286 Canal Street & 2 Kimball Street ANRAD –DEP# 64-###– Abbreviated Notice of Resource Area Delineation for Juniper Point Investment Company, 886 Hale Street, Beverly MA. This is to consider boundaries and extent of wetland resource areas, including Bordering Vegetated Wetlands, Riverfront Area to South River, and Land Subject to Coastal Storm Flowage, for the properties located at: 282, 282R, 266, and 286 Canal Street; and 2 Kimball Road, subject to protection under the Wetlands Protection Act MGL c.131§40 and Salem Wetlands Protection & Conservation Ordinance 

E. 57 Memorial Drive NOI  - DEP# 64-### –Notice of Intent for Justin Mattera, 57 Memorial Drive for proposed house and deck additions, renovation and repair to existing house, and driveway and landscaping site work, within an area subject to protection under the Wetlands Protection Act MGL c.131§40 and Salem Wetlands Protection & Conservation Ordinance. 

F. Forest River Conservation Area – RDA  - Request for Determination of Applicability for the City of Salem, 98 Washington Street, Salem, MA for the rehabilitation and access improvements of the Forest River Conservation Area Volunteer Bridge subject to protection under the Wetlands Protection Act MGL c.131§40 and Salem Wetlands Protection & Conservation Ordinance.
